It was shot at Monte Velino, which lies in the province of L'Aquila in the Abruzzo region. The mountain has a peak elevation of just under 2.5k meters (a bit under 8.2k ft.) above sea level. It's the third highest peak in the Appenines, a chain which runs down the "spine" of Italy. Like much of the chain, Monte Velino is known for its spectacular rock formations and ridges.
